OVERVIEW:
The White Glove Home Inspector / Maintenance Technician is responsible for providing exceptional care and oversight of private residences and Glacier Club facilities. This role focuses on routine home inspections for members while they are away, ensuring homes are fully operational, secure, and member/guest-ready upon arrival.
The ideal candidate is highly detail-oriented, proactive, and skilled in general maintenance. This position requires the ability to identify issues, perform minor repairs, create clear inspection reports, and respond quickly to member requests with professionalism and urgency.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S (JOB DUTIES):
White Glove Inspector (~70%):
Perform periodic inspections of private residences to identify potential issues or abnormalities.
Inspect HVAC, plumbing, electrical systems, appliances, toilets, doors/windows, batteries, remotes, security systems, and general home conditions.
Create detailed inspection reports and communicate findings for owner review and repair approvals.
Coordinate daily with White Glove Manager.
Perform minor repairs and maintenance as approved.
Ensure homes are secure, clean, and fully operational for member arrival.
Assist with package delivery, furniture moving, trash service, and other homeowner requests.
Maintenance Technician (~30%):
Perform general maintenance and repairs on Glacier Club facilities and equipment.
Troubleshoot and repair plumbing, electrical, HVAC, drywall, painting, carpentry, and other building systems.
Assist with pool and hot tub maintenance.
Respond to maintenance requests and urgent issues as needed.
Support the Facilities team with all operational needs and maintenance schedules.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Strong attention to detail and ability to work independently.
Experience in general maintenance, home inspection, or related trades preferred.
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.
Ability to prioritize tasks and adapt to changing needs.
Excellent communication and customer service skills.
Proficiency with basic computer programs for reporting.
Must be an individual of the utmost integrity: trustworthy, professional, and able to work in private homes.
E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:
High School Diploma or equivalent required.
Minimum one year of maintenance, facilities, or residential inspection experience preferred.
Valid driver’s license required. Must be legally licensed to operate a private passenger vehicle and have no DWI/DUI citations within the last 5 years. Customer service experience in a transportation role is a plus (shuttle, bussing, taxi, valet, etc.).
P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:
Must be able to perform tasks that require stooping, bending, squatting, kneeling, climbing stairs, climbing ladders, walking indoors, working at heights, lifting up to 50 lbs., carrying up to 50 lbs., reaching above the shoulder, reaching at shoulder level, and reaching below the shoulder.
